Why Ball Bearing Is Essential



Modern Ball Bearings provide smooth rotational movement by using precision steel balls between inner and outer races. Ball Bearing solutions are frequently installed in electric motors, household appliances, industrial machinery, automotive systems, and precision equipment. Benefits of Roller Bearing



A Roller Bearing uses cylindrical rollers instead of balls. Because of their design they provide greater load capacity. Industries frequently rely on Roller Bearings in construction machinery, mining equipment, gearboxes, conveyors, and heavy industrial systems. Their robust construction helps reduce maintenance.

Insert Ball Bearing Applications



Modern Insert Ball Bearings offer convenient installation for agricultural and manufacturing equipment. Such bearing solutions allow dependable shaft alignment while providing excellent operational stability. Manufacturers frequently install them in conveyors, agricultural machinery, food processing equipment, and packaging systems.

Understanding Thrust Ball Bearing



A Thrust Ball Bearing is designed for high axial load requirements. Compared with conventional bearing designs perform best under axial loading conditions. Typical applications include automotive transmissions, machine tools, pumps, and industrial equipment. Choosing the right thrust bearing improves efficiency.

The Benefits of Self-Aligning Ball Bearing



A Self-Aligning Ball Bearing automatically compensates for shaft misalignment. Its self-correcting capability improves bearing performance. Industries commonly utilize Self-Aligning Ball Bearings in equipment exposed to alignment variations. Reliable alignment capability supports better machine efficiency.
